EBITDA Margin % is calculated as EBITDA divided by its Revenue. Bursa De Valori Bucuresti's EBITDA for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was lei13.14 Mil. Bursa De Valori Bucuresti's Revenue for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was lei28.11 Mil. Therefore, Bursa De Valori Bucuresti's EBITDA margin for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 46.75%.


Bursa De Valori Bucuresti  (BSE:BVB) EBITDA Margin % Explanation

EBITDA Margin % is the ratio of EBITDA divided by net sales or Revenue. It is an performance metric measuring company's operating profitability. EBITDA Margin takes depreciation and amortization, interest expense and tax into account, which makes it easy to compare the relative profitability of companies of different sizes in the same industry.

Bursa De Valori Bucuresti Business Description

Other Exchanges N0N:Germany
Address 4-8 Nicolae Titulescu Avenue, 1st Floor, East Wing, America House Building, District 1, Bucharest, ROU, 011141
Bursa De Valori Bucuresti SA is engaged in the management and operation of financial markets. The company operates through four business segments, including Capital Markets, Post-trading Services, Registry Services, and CCP.RO Services. The Capital Markets segment involves trading in securities and financial instruments on regulated markets. Post-trading Services include services provided after the completion of transactions until funds are received and securities are transferred to portfolios. Registry Services involve maintaining and updating shareholder registers for listed companies. CCP.RO Services relate to the implementation and operation of central counterparty activities. The majority of the company's revenue is generated from Capital Markets trading services.
